PTSD Edinburgh Services and Emotional Recovery
Traumatic experiences can leave long-lasting emotional effects that interfere with daily life. PTSD Edinburgh Services support individuals who continue to experience emotional distress after traumatic events such as accidents, abuse, violence, grief, military experiences, medical emergencies, or childhood neglect.
Post-traumatic stress disorder may affect people differently. Some individuals experience flashbacks, nightmares, panic attacks, emotional numbness, or avoidance behaviours. Others may struggle with anger, fear, sleep difficulties, or feelings of isolation. PTSD symptoms can impact work, relationships, concentration, and physical health if left untreated.
Professional therapy creates a safe environment where clients can process traumatic experiences gradually and at a pace that feels manageable. Trauma-focused therapy helps individuals understand how trauma affects the mind and body while developing healthier coping mechanisms.
PTSD Edinburgh Services often include therapeutic techniques that help reduce emotional triggers and improve emotional regulation. Therapists may help clients identify trauma responses, manage distressing thoughts, and reduce feelings of fear associated with traumatic memories.
Healing from trauma is rarely immediate. Many people require ongoing support and emotional reassurance while processing painful experiences. Counselling provides consistent emotional care that helps clients rebuild confidence and regain a sense of control in life.

Anxiety Counselling Edinburgh and Daily Stress Management
Anxiety can affect both mental and physical wellbeing. People experiencing anxiety often feel persistent worry, fear, tension, racing thoughts, or physical symptoms such as headaches, rapid heartbeat, and sleep problems. Anxiety counselling edinburgh services support individuals struggling with excessive stress, panic attacks, social fears, and ongoing emotional pressure.
Anxiety may develop because of workplace stress, traumatic experiences, relationship difficulties, financial concerns, or unresolved emotional issues. For some people, anxiety gradually becomes part of daily life, making routine activities feel emotionally draining.
Therapy helps clients understand anxiety triggers and recognise thought patterns that increase emotional distress. Counsellors may introduce coping strategies that help reduce panic symptoms and emotional overwhelm. Clients often learn grounding techniques, emotional regulation skills, and healthier stress management methods during sessions.
Anxiety counselling edinburgh services also support individuals who feel emotionally stuck or unable to relax. Therapy provides an opportunity to discuss worries openly while receiving emotional support from a trained professional.
Many people notice improvements in sleep, emotional balance, communication, and self-confidence after attending counselling sessions consistently. Therapy can also improve work performance and relationship stability by helping individuals manage stress more effectively.
